Governing the American Lake: the Us Defense and Administration of the Pacific Basin, 1945-1947
Hal M. Friedman
Contends that US fears after World War II led the nation into military domination of the Pacific Ocean, turning it into an "American lake" in the hope of keeping the mainland safe from attack. This work also describes the many conflicts between military and civilian services in the period immediately following the war.
